English My desire to shoot in Ecuador comes with a wish for connecting more to this country and the stories and situations I have experienced there. I’m especially attracted to the strange and mysterious stories, encounters, objects and situations, that I have found while travelling on the roads there. Due to my origins, that combine two different cultures and unite sometimes contrasting perspectives, Ecuador feels like a place that produces a lot of absurd situations. There might be many explanations for a certain situation and also space for me to imagine and provide these explanations myself. It is a powerful motor that stimulates questions and imaginations.
